Additional introduction of F35:

In December 2018, the Japanese government approved an additional introduction plan for the F35, including the F35B.

At that time, Japan introduced 42 F35A aircraft (one crashed in April 2019).

In addition, 105 aircraft (F35A = 63 aircraft, F35B = 42 aircraft) will be introduced.

Marine Corps F-35B Conduct First Landing Aboard JS Izumo

MCAS IWAKUNI, Japan

At the request of the Japan Maritime Self-Defense Force,

Marine Fighter Attack Squadron 242 successfully conducted the first ever landing of two F-35B Lightning II aircraft aboard the Japanese Ship Izumo on Oct. 3.

Following a series of modifications to the JS Izumo to enable short take-off and vertical landing operations,

a capability that the “B” variant of the F-35 specializes in, U.S. Marines embarked aboard the JS Izumo

and worked directly with JMSDF personnel as part of a bilateral effort to ensure the capability test was both effective and safe.

“This trial has proved that the JS Izumo has the capability to support takeoffs and landings of STOVL aircraft at sea, which will allow us to provide an additional option for air defense in the Pacific Ocean in the near future,”

said JMSDF Rear Adm.

Shukaku Komuta, commander of Escort Flotilla One.
